HACK 12 – STOP STROKES

Stroke, the destruction of brain cells that occurs when blood to the brain is cut off, can kill you (it’s the fifth leading cause of death in the US). If it doesn’t kill you, it may leave you physically and/or mentally impaired—permanently. Stroke can be caused by blood clots or hardening of the arteries (atherosclerosis), although occasionally it is the result of trauma. Your chance of a stroke increases dramat- ically after you hit fifty-five and continues increasing as you age. Current research from a long-term study on Alzheimer’s and aging suggests that having a stroke can put you at greater risk for developing Alzheimer’s. Risk factors for stroke include:  

  • High blood pressure
  • Heart disease
  • Smoking
  • High cholesterol
  • Diabetes

If you have any of these risk factors, take concrete steps to safeguard your brain.
